Type of Humidification

The type of humidification method employed by a gas heater humidifier is another crucial consideration when choosing the right device for your home. Different types of humidification, such as evaporative or ultrasonic, offer distinct advantages and disadvantages based on their operational mechanisms. Understanding the unique features of each type of humidification allows homeowners to select the most suitable option based on their preferences and requirements. For instance, evaporative humidifiers are known for their energy efficiency and ability to add moisture to the air through natural evaporation, while ultrasonic humidifiers are appreciated for their quiet operation and versatility in humidifying various room sizes.

Maintenance Tips

Regular Cleaning Procedures

Regular cleaning is a fundamental aspect of maintaining gas heater humidifiers. Cleaning procedures involve removing dust, mineral deposits, and any microbial growth that could affect the unit's performance. Regular cleaning of the water tank, humidifier chamber, and components like filters and vents helps prevent blockages and ensures hygienic operation. By following a routine cleaning schedule, homeowners can mitigate issues related to mold, bacteria, and other contaminants, promoting healthy indoor air quality.

Changing Filters

Changing filters regularly is a key maintenance practice for gas heater humidifiers. Filters play a vital role in capturing impurities from the water supply before releasing moisture into the air. Over time, filters may become clogged with debris, reducing the humidifier's effectiveness. By replacing filters as recommended by the manufacturer, homeowners can sustain optimal air quality and prevent the circulation of pollutants. Timely filter changes also prolong the lifespan of the humidifier and contribute to its efficient operation, ensuring continuous comfort in the home.
